What is DevOps Automation?

DevOps automation is the practice of using tools and processes to automate software development, testing, deployment, and infrastructure management.

Core Components:

  • Continuous Integration (CI)
  • Continuous Deployment (CD)
  • Infrastructure as Code (IaC)
  • Monitoring & Logging
  • Automated Testing

Technology Stack for DevOps Automation

CategoryTools/Technologies
CategoryTechnology Stack
Frontend & BackendReact / Next.js, Flutter, FastAPI / Node.js
ContainerizationDocker
OrchestrationKubernetes
CI/CD ToolsGitHub Actions, GitLab CI/CD, Jenkins
Infrastructure as CodeTerraform, AWS CloudFormation
Cloud PlatformsAWS, Azure, Google Cloud
Monitoring ToolsPrometheus, Grafana, Datadog

Step-by-Step DevOps Automation Strategy

StepDescription
Step 1: Version Control SetupUse Git-based workflows
Step 2: Build CI PipelineAutomate code testing, build processes
Step 3: Implement CD PipelineEnable automatic deployments
Step 4: Containerize ApplicationsUse Docker for consistency
Step 5: Use Infrastructure as CodeAutomate infrastructure provisioning
Step 6: Set Up MonitoringTrack system performance in real-time
Step 7: Enable Auto ScalingHandle traffic spikes efficiently

FAQ

1. What is DevOps automation?

DevOps automation involves automating software development, testing, deployment, and infrastructure processes.

2. Why is DevOps important for startups?

It helps startups scale faster, reduce errors, and improve deployment speed.

3. What tools are used in DevOps automation?

Popular tools include Docker, Kubernetes, Jenkins, GitHub Actions, and Terraform.

4. How does CI/CD help startups?

CI/CD enables continuous integration and deployment, reducing manual work and speeding up releases.

5. Can small startups adopt DevOps?

Yes, even small startups benefit from DevOps by improving efficiency and scalability.
